Jalen Brunson’s effect on the Knicks has been massive. When
he signed with the Knicks, fans were not expecting much, but Brunson became the
main piece of New York’s offense very quickly. Recognized for his mid-range
game, great footwork, and high basketball IQ, Brunson averaged over 29 points
and 7 assists per game last season. Brunson is much more than just a scorer,
he’s a leader, a playmaker, and a clutch player in close games these are traits
that have not been in Madison Square Garden for years.
